BOSTON -- Junior Amy Wilfert (Westborough, MA) continued
her outstanding cross country season by finishing 11th at the 2009
New England Intercollegiate Amateur Athletic Association (NEIAAA)
Cross Country Championship held at Franklin Park in Boston on
Saturday.
Wilfert ran 18:18 and was the second Division III finisher at the
race, behind only MIT's Jacqui Wentz (18:06 for third place). Narrowly
edged out of the top 10 this year, Wilfert was 21st in the race last
season. This year she led the Tufts team to a 22nd place finish overall
out of 49 teams. The top five Jumbo finishes added up to 680 overall.
The NEIAAA's feature Division I, II and III teams. Brown University
won the team title with a 130 score. Corey Conner from Maine took the
individual title with a 17:36 finish.
Sophomore Bryn Kass (Santa Barbara, CA) continued to firmly
establish herself as the team's #2, finishing 115th overall in 19:37.
The third Jumbo finisher on Saturday was sophomore Anya Price
(Natick, MA), whose 20:05 time was 171st.
The fourth and fifth scorers for Tufts were junior Jen Yih (Palo
Alto, CA) and sophomore Kelsey Picciuto (Cornwall, NY) with
20:14 (176th) and 20:42 (207th) times, respectively.
The Jumbos run at Williams College next Saturday.
